Qaitbay Citadel

The Qaitbay citadel is considered to be one of the most famous and charming landmarks in Alexandria, as it was the strongest fortress that was located in the Mediterranean Sea, therefore you’ll enjoy wondering at this marvelous citadel with Flying Carpet Tours, it also will take you back in time, as it was built in the 1480 A.D by the Sultan Al Ashraf Qaitbay, it was located in the ruins of the amazing Lighthouse of Alexandria which was considered to be one of the famous Seven Wonders in the ancient world.

 

 

This citadel is located at the entrance of the eastern part of the Pharaos Island, there was also a beautiful mosque inside it, the Qauitbay Citadel was also being used until the periods of the Mameluke, Ottoman, but they stopped using it after the British bombed Alexandria in 1883, therefore it became neglected till the twentieth century although it was restored to be saved from damaging many times by the Egyptian Supreme Counsel of Antiquities.
